Name of the Vulnerable Software and Affected Versions Adobe Acrobat versions (affected versions not specified) Adobe Acrobat Document Cloud versions (affected versions not specified) Adobe Reader versions (affected versions not specified) Adobe Reader Document Cloud versions (affected versions not specified)
Description The issue is related to insufficient access restrictions to certain features in the CBBBRInvite method of Adobe Acrobat and Adobe Acrobat Document Cloud for editing PDF files, and Adobe Reader and Adobe Reader Document Cloud for viewing PDF files. This can allow a remote attacker to bypass JavaScript execution restrictions.
Recommendations For Adobe Acrobat, update to a version that addresses the CBBBRInvite method issue. For Adobe Acrobat Document Cloud, restrict access to the CBBBRInvite method until a patch is available. For Adobe Reader, consider disabling JavaScript execution in the affected API until the issue is resolved. For Adobe Reader Document Cloud, avoid using the vulnerable CBBBRInvite method in the affected API endpoint until the issue is resolved. As a temporary workaround, consider restricting the use of the CBBBRInvite method in Adobe Acrobat and Adobe Reader until a patch is available.
